Abstract

The dental biofilm can biodegrade the surfaces of restorative materials and to adapt to changes in the oral environment. However, few is known about the precise structure of the biofilm and how it interacts with the restorative material, being a challenge to control its growth by antimicrobial agents or other strategies. This study will evaluate, in situ, biofilm/restorative material interactions through quantitative and qualitative analyses. Ten discs of each material analyzed (IPS Empress 2 - control, Filtek Supreme; Vitremer; Ketak molar Easymix; Tytin) will be made in a metal matrix of 5.0mm x 2.0mm. Roughness and microhardness of each specimens will be initially evaluated. Ten volunteers will be selected to use palatal devices containing specimens of each experimental group. The experiment will consist of two phases: first, the volunteers will use the palatal devices for 48 hours and in the second phase, for 14 days. After the experimental periods, laser microscopy confocal analyses will be performed to visualize the architecture and viability of the biofilm. The images will be analyzed using COMSTAT software, which will allow the evaluation of bio-volume, roughness coefficient and biofilm surface/volume ratio. In addition, the restorative materials will be analysed after interaction with the biofilm, using scanning electron microscopy (MEV), energy dispersive spectroscopy (EDS), roughness and final hardness tests. All the data will be submitted to statistical analysis. (AU)
